Output b1506a2667b29dd36b4a2da30570336c8351fe5a8d6b94dcf675913e78d2a7c4:0

value
16388917
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afe66d71e9d56db74e425632f5eaded9469e57b7 OP_EQUAL
address
3Hj6DVtF81Ewr59NL4KwQv2V8WHTYPWhfH
transaction
b1506a2667b29dd36b4a2da30570336c8351fe5a8d6b94dcf675913e78d2a7c4
spent
true